Eleanor,
I don't think your unkown iris is any of those whose names you have
mentioned. It is similar to Tennessee Woman in general appearance, but TW
has darker standards and a wider band of plicata markings on the falls. It
does have the "look" of a Sterling Innerst plicata, however. Perhaps
someone who is familiar with more of them, particularly some of the earlier
ones, could suggest an identification.
